THE UPTOWN COLLECTIVE
The ARTS have shown themselves to not only insert cultural enterprise into the world, but also serve as a healing tool. The Uptown Collective is a community that helps develop and support the whole artist: mind, body and spirit.
The Uptown Collective is designed to not only connect artists across multiple genres but engage them in creating, developing and producing original work.
The Griot Circle is a generative writing workshop led by Jamal Joseph, where participants aged 50+ create new works across poetry, memoir, short story, monologue, or scene, honoring the rich tradition of storytelling through fresh creative expression.
In the spirit of the African griot, this generative writing workshop invites participants to create new short works in their chosen form—memoir, short story, poetry, monologue, or scene. It is a space to birth new stories, not revise old ones.

COMPONENTS OF THE COLLECTIVE
CONTENT Programs and classes that help advance your skills.
CREATION Plays, web series, bands, etc. Projects that needs workshopping, incubation, and/or space for development.
CONVERSATIONS Collective Conversations and talkbacks, discussion groups, wellness support groups
COACHING Classes taught by fellow artists, mentorship matchups, one-on-one conversations with experts
COLLABORATION Partnerships with arts-based organizations to expand funding and performance opportunities.

The Uptown Collective is for you! We are always on the hunt for writers and actors. Let us host your first table read or staged reading. UC table reads are closed-door sessions involving a writer and professional actors. Staged readings are public performances involving a writer, professional actors and an audience.
